O16/158 Artificial Intelligence based nationwide centralised decision supporting system for improving stroke case efficiency in Hungary
ConclusionUsing AI based centralized stroke imaging network fast and reliable decision support can be provided to a large nationwide stroke care system. E-007 CLEVER: clinical evaluation of WEB 0.017 device in intracranial aneurysms - final results for ruptured and unruptured aneurysm at 12 months
ConclusionThese results show good efficacy and safety results at 12 months month, and no WEB related mortality at 12 months. These data confirm the safety and efficacy of WEB 0.017 use in intracranial aneurysm treatment, unruptured as well as ruptured, and are consistent with the results published up to date.Disclosures L. O-003 CLEVER: clinical evaluation of WEB 17 device in intracranial aneurysms. safety results for ruptured and unruptured aneurysm at 30 days
ConclusionThese results show good safety profile at 1 month, with low rate of neurological or neurovascular event with permanent deficit and no mortality at 30 days. These data confirm the safety of WEB use in intracranial aneurysm treatment, unruptured as well as ruptured, and are consistent with the results published up to date.Disclosures L. EP39* Collateral damages of COVID-19 on the hungarian ischemic stroke care
ConclusionsCollateral damages of the COVID-19 outbreak on the Hungarian IS care system were demonstrated. The disproportionally greater decline of IS admission numbers could partially be explained by the effect of health emergency operative measures.
